verb
- past tense and past participle of remotivate; to motivate again or anew
Examples
- The coach remotivated the team after their disappointing loss.
- She was remotivated by her mentor’s encouraging words.
- The new project remotivated him to work harder.
- After the setback, they remotivated themselves to continue.
- The inspiring speech remotivated the entire workforce.
- He remotivated his students with a fresh teaching approach.
